Job Description

Maintain the safety, security, growth, and profitability of the DC by supporting daily Loss Prevention and Safety (LP&S) functions. Provide training, guidance, and direction to employees to ensure compliance with safety standards, regulatory requirements, and company objectives, contributing to the growth and profitability of the facility. This is a 2nd shift opportunity and the normal hours will be M-F 4pm to 12:30am.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Open and close the building daily, including management of alarm systems, badge access, and CCTV surveillance equipment.
  • Conduct safety related trainings, including safety orientations and power equipment training.
  • Ensure compliance with CTPAT guidelines and regulations.
  • Investigate and document workplace accidents and injuries to determine root causes.
  • Conduct internal and external safety and security patrols and audits.
  • Monitor guard shack activity and incidents.
  • Drive departmental productivity and efficiency while maintaining high standards of quality and safety.
  • Coach and support the Loss Prevention & Safety Clerk to foster growth and development.
  • Any other tasks as assigned by supervisor or manager.

About OrthoVirginia

With more than 160 orthopedic specialists in 36 locations in Virginia, OrthoVirginia is Virginia’s largest provider of orthopedic medicine and one of the leading providers of physical, hand and occupational therapy. As one of the largest orthopedic specialty practices in the country, OrthoVirginia’s nationally-recognized physicians provide advanced surgical and non-surgical care to patients of all ages.

OrthoVirginia is the official Orthopedic and Sports Medicine Partner of the Washington Commanders.

Our offices include on-site physical, hand and occupational therapy, surgery centers, and diagnostic imaging including x-ray, ultrasound and MRI. As an independent practice, our physicians are invested in providing comprehensive care to patients in our communities. We support local community organizations with financial and medical assistance to help build the wellness of people living in our cities and neighborhoods.
